Aloniogbo[1] (Alọniogbó)
Pronunciation (help·info) is a Nigerian male given name of Ekpeye origin[2] which means "Let us come out in our numbers." It is a diminutive version of names such as "Ogbobuike" and "Ogboka" which means Unity is strenght.[3]
